Frequently Asked Questions

What unique natural monuments can I discover around Etagnières?

The region offers a variety of natural monuments. You can visit the historically significant Soldiers' Fountain, the ancient The Old Oak of Place de l'Orme, Morrens with its panoramic views, or the tranquil Louis Bourget Park Beach, the only natural beach on Lake Geneva in the Lausanne area.

Are there any historical natural monuments in the Etagnières area?

Yes, the Soldiers' Fountain has a unique history, once serving as a water source for soldiers traveling between barracks and a shooting range. Additionally, The Old Oak of Place de l'Orme, Morrens is an ancient natural monument, estimated to be 600 to 700 years old, offering a glimpse into the region's past.

What kind of natural features can I expect to see in Etagnières?

Etagnières is characterized by serene and well-preserved landscapes, including picturesque countryside, lush forests, and the romantic Talent stream. You'll find extensive networks of paths winding through these areas, offering scenic views and a peaceful atmosphere.

Are there family-friendly natural monuments or activities in Etagnières?

Absolutely. Louis Bourget Park Beach is ideal for families, offering swimming and walks along Lake Geneva. The Old Oak of Place de l'Orme, Morrens also features a play area and a petanque court, making it a great spot for families. The easy paths along the Talent stream are also suitable for family strolls.

Where can I find a natural beach near Etagnières?

The Louis Bourget Park Beach is the only natural beach on Lake Geneva in the Lausanne area, offering over a kilometer of lakefront suitable for swimming and walks. It's a popular spot for families and students from spring to autumn.

What are the best hiking opportunities near the natural monuments?

The region offers numerous hiking and walking trails that traverse forests and countryside. You can explore routes along the Talent stream, which has well-developed natural paths with minimal elevation changes. For more options, check out the dedicated guide for Natural Monuments around Etagnières.

Are there any waterfalls to visit in the Etagnières region?

Yes, the Tine de Conflens Waterfall is an accessible and mystical place. If water levels are low, you might even find a small sand beach by the waterfall. In extremely cold weather, it partly freezes, creating a wonderful spectacle.

When is the best time to see daffodils in Etagnières?

Between March and April, you can witness the beautiful sight of daffodils blooming on Le Mormont. The forest there is full of small trails, perfect for enjoying this seasonal display.
